A critical component of this ecosystem in Hong Kong is the Faster Payment System (FPS). FPS is a real-time payment platform that allows users to transfer Hong Kong Dollars (HKD) instantly between banks and Stored Value Facilities (SVFs) using just a mobile number or email address. Lowest-Fee Methods for HKD to IDR Transfers

Minimizing costs is often the primary objective when transferring a Personal Savings & Retirement Fund. Over time, high transaction fees and poor exchange rates can significantly erode the value of your savings. Historically, users relied on traditional banks and wire transfers. While secure, these methods are often the most expensive. A standard wire transfer via SWIFT from a major Hong Kong bank can incur a fixed handling fee ranging from HKD 60 to HKD 200, plus a markup on the exchange rate that can be as high as 2-3%.

In contrast, fintech remittance apps have revolutionized the cost structure. By utilizing digital networks rather than the aging correspondent banking system, these providers can offer rates much closer to the mid-market exchange rate.

Fastest Methods to Send Money to Indonesia

Speed is the currency of the modern world. When an emergency strikes—be it a medical bill or an urgent repair for a family home—waiting days for funds to clear is not an option. This is where the disparity between traditional banking and digital remittance becomes most apparent.

Traditional banks in Hong Kong, such as HSBC, Standard Chartered, or Bank of China (Hong Kong), are pillars of the financial system. However, their international transfer processes often rely on the SWIFT network. While reliable, SWIFT transfers can take anywhere from 2 to 5 business days to settle in an Indonesian bank account. Furthermore, cut-off times and weekends can delay the process even further.

Safety and Compliance in Remittance

Security is non-negotiable when dealing with cross-border finance. In Hong Kong, the remittance sector is strictly regulated to prevent money laundering and ensure consumer protection. Legitimate remittance providers must hold a Money Service Operator (MSO) license, which mandates strict adherence to financial laws.

When you sign up for a service like Panda Remit, you will be required to complete a Know Your Customer (KYC) process. This usually involves uploading a Hong Kong ID or passport and performing a facial recognition scan. While this might seem like an extra step, it is a hallmark of a secure platform.
